Pillared porphyrin homologous series: intergrowth in metal-organic frameworks.

Eun-Young Choi1, Paul M Barron, Richard W Novotny, Hyun-Tak Son, Chunhua Hu, Wonyoung Choe.   

Abstract

We report three new porphyrin-based, pillared paddle-wheel homologous series: porphyrin paddle-wheel frameworks PPF-3, -4, and -5. These compounds are assembled from free base or palladium tetrakis(4-carboxyphenyl)porphine, M(NO(3))(2) (M = Co and Zn), and 4,4'-bipyridine via solvothermal reactions. The resulting solids exhibit 3D metal-organic frameworks, where 2D layers are pillared by bipyridine with three different packing arrangements.
